It’s best to exchange cash with your local bank before traveling to vietnam. while there are atms at the airports, they will often have a bad exchange rate. the local currency in vietnam is called the vietnamese dong. one u.s. dollar is equivalent to around 23,640 vnd (as of july 2023). 16. know your loos. western style sit down toilets are increasingly common in vietnam, but you’ll often have to pay to use public loos, and paper is rarely provided. carry your own, or use the hose or water jug provided. bring antibacterial hand gel or soap; many bathrooms only provide running water. 17.

To enter vietnam, you will need to bring your passport which is valid for at least 6 months on arrival & enough blank page for visa stamped on it. a valid visa will be required for citizens from most foreign countries come to vietnam for any purposes. Visas & passport guidelines for vietnam. all visitors will need a valid passport to visit vietnam. for best practice, ensure that it does not expire for 6 months. most travelers need a visa to travel to vietnam. you can apply for a visa online, at a vietnamese embassy or consulate, or through a visa service. the cost of the vietnam visa is $25.
